From: Significance of myelodysplastic syndrome-associated somatic variants in the evaluation of patients with pancytopenia and idiopathic cytopenias of undetermined significance

Figure 1

Frequency of mutations in 20 genes in 91 cases of pancytopenia. (a) Percent of cases with at least one mutation (P=0.012 chi-square test). (b) Distribution of the frequency of cases with 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, or 5 mutations per case. (c) Percent of cases with at least one mutation in different age decades. The asterisk indicates that P<0.05, Fisher’s exact test. IP, idiopathic pancytopenia cases; M, malignant cases.
